Essential Equipment for a Home DJ Studio

For aspiring DJs who want to take their craft to the next level, having a home DJ studio is essential. Creating a space where you can practice, mix, and experiment with your music is crucial for honing your skills and creativity. To set up a functional and efficient home DJ studio, you’ll need to invest in some essential equipment.

One key piece of equipment for a home DJ studio is a reliable DJ controller. This device allows you to control and manipulate your music files, adjust pitch, tempo, and volume, and seamlessly transition between tracks. There are many different types and brands of DJ controllers available, so you’ll want to choose one that suits your needs and preferences. Some popular options include the Pioneer DDJ-SB3, Numark Mixtrack Pro 3, and Native Instruments Traktor Kontrol S4.

In addition to a DJ controller, you’ll also need a good pair of DJ headphones. These are essential for monitoring your mix and ensuring that you can hear the music clearly. Look for headphones that offer good sound quality, comfort, and noise isolation. Some top-rated DJ headphones include the Sennheiser HD 25, Audio-Technica ATH-M50x, and Pioneer HDJ-X5.

Another essential piece of equipment for a home DJ studio is a set of studio monitors. These speakers are designed specifically for music production and are crucial for accurately hearing your mix and making adjustments as needed. Some popular studio monitor brands include KRK, Yamaha, and JBL.

To enhance your mixing and performance capabilities, consider investing in a MIDI keyboard or pad controller. These devices allow you to trigger samples, loops, and effects, as well as play melodies and chords. They can add a new dimension to your DJ sets and allow you to express your creativity in unique ways.

Lastly, don’t forget about the importance of organization and comfort in your home DJ studio. Invest in a good-quality DJ laptop stand to keep your computer at an optimal height and angle for easy access. Consider adding a desk or table for your equipment and storage for cables, accessories, and music records.

Setting up a home DJ studio can be a fun and rewarding experience, and having the right equipment is crucial for success. By investing in essential gear like a DJ controller, headphones, studio monitors, and MIDI keyboard, you’ll be well on your way to creating the perfect space for honing your DJ skills.
